Medical Tourism (also referred to as Health Tourism, Medical Travel and International Healthcare) is a term describing patients receiving medical care across their national borders. Although it may seem that this is a fairly new industry, history shows us that the phenomenon of medical travel exists for centuries, all the way back to ancient times. Today, the modern medical tourism industry offers a good, alternative solution to a number of problems patients might have with receiving local healthcare.

Thanks to rapid improvements in global transportation means in the past few decades, patients have been able to travel in a much easier way than before. Add this to the massive development of the internet, bringing our world closer together with endless amounts of free information, and medical tourism has been made simple for patients who beforehand were unable to pursue medical treatments abroad, after not being able to receive proper medical care in their own country.
Different aspects of globalization have led to the rise in the quality of medical care around the world, as countless countries offer healthcare that is up to par with American medicine standards. This means that Medical travelers can receive every medical treatment abroad they choose to from the long list of medical services available such as the popular plastic surgery procedures and dental surgery, but not only, as heart surgery, total joint replacements (knee/hip) and cancer treatments are also familiar fields in the growing medical tourism industry.
